Employer Paid Covid-Related Leave Tax Credits

Coronavirus Posting Compliance Whitepaper

The mandate to provide paid leave under the Families First Coronavirus Response Act (FFCRA) expired on December 31, 2020, but employers may continue to allow employees to take the paid leave until September 30, 2021 and receive tax credits for providing the leave.

The FFCRA’s goal of helping to reduce the spread of the COVID-19 virus was successful, and employers may benefit from continuing to allow the leave as an incentive for employees to say home when they have symptoms or test positive; thereby keeping their workplace and employees safe.
